A relay doesn't have to be on a computer that is separate from the clients.
If I start getting censored by relays, I can host my own relay. I can even build the relay into my client and merge them as one.
At the limit, #nostr becomes peer to peer. This can be done as needed so users can balance their concerns for censorship resistance vs performance.
